рекомендации

четверг, 27 февраля 2020 г.

Скрипт "Install GNOME Themes" для установки более 40 популярных тем Gtk для GNOME

Если вы хотите легко попробовать самые популярные темы Gnome, или если вы часто меняете тему Gtk, то «Install The GNOME Themes» для вас.

Это скрипт, который устанавливает более 40 популярных тем Gnome (и это не считая светлых/темных или компактных вариантов), загружая их свежий код из Git. Темы автоматически создаются из исходного кода при необходимости и устанавливаются в папку пользователя ~/.themes.

Чтобы упростить установку, репозиторий проекта также содержит два других скрипта, которые автоматически устанавливают зависимости, для Fedora и Debian (включая Ubuntu и т. д.). Глядя на хранилище скриптов, кажется, что скрипт поддерживает не только Fedora и Debian/Ubuntu, но и Arch Linux (он выполняет некоторые проверки версий Gtk, которые являются специфичными для дистрибутива). Я все же попробовал это только на Ubuntu и Fedora.

Темы, устанавливаемые этим скриптом: Adapta, Adwaita Tweaks, Amber, Ant, Aqua, Arc (Firefox themes: Arc, Arc Darker, Arc Dark), Arc-Flatabulous, Arc-Red, Blue-Face, Breeze, Candra, Canta, Chrome-OS, Ciliora-Secunda, Ciliora-Tertia, Cloak, EvoPop, Fresh-Finesse, Greybird, macOS-Sierra, Materia (formerly Flat-Plat), Minwaita, Numix, Numix-Base16-Ocean, OSX-Arc-Darker, Paper, Plano, Plata, Pop, Pocillo, Qogir, Redmond-Themes (Windows 3.x, 95, 98, Vista и 8.1), Typewriter, United GNOME, Unity7, Unity8, Vertex, Vimix, Xenlism-Minimalism, Yaru (ранее Communitheme) и Zuki.

Скриншоты с несколькими из этих тем:


Ant Gtk theme 



Breeze Gtk theme



Cloak Gtk theme



macOS Sierra Gtk theme



Minwaita Gtk theme



Pop Gtk theme



United Ubuntu Gtk theme



Windows 8.1 (Redmond) theme

Скрипт также устанавливает тему оболочки Gnome, если она доступна. Темы Xfwm4, Openbox или Cinnamon также устанавливаются для большинства тем, которые их поддерживают. Однако, если тема содержит отдельные темы Chrome или Firefox или некоторые другие настройки, они должны быть установлены отдельно.

Однако этому скрипту не хватает одной вещи - возможности указать, какие темы устанавливать. В настоящее время скрипт устанавливает все поддерживаемые им темы, не позволяя пользователю выбирать, какие темы устанавливать.

"Install GNOME Themes" - скачивание и запуск скрипта

Я рекомендую проверить код, используемый в этом скрипте (и не только в этом, но и в любом другом скрипте, который вы запускаете, который вы не написали сами), и запускать его, только если у вас есть хотя бы некоторое базовое понимание того, что он делает!

Чтобы получить свежий код «Install GNOME Themes» из Git, убедитесь, что у вас установлен Git:

Debian/Ubuntu:

sudo apt install git

Fedora:

sudo dnf install git

Теперь вы можете клонировать Git-репозиторий «Install GNOME Themes»:

git clone https://github.com/tliron/install-gnome-themes

Запустите скрипт, который устанавливает требования к Debian/Ubuntu и Fedora:

Debian/Ubuntu:

./install-gnome-themes/install-requirements-debian

Fedora:

./install-gnome-themes/install-requirements-fedora

И, наконец, запустите скрипт «Install GNOME Themes» для установки более 40 тем Gnome:

./install-gnome-themes/install-gnome-themes

Стоит отметить, что в моем случае скрипт показывал сообщение «install-gnome-themes fail!» о завершении установки тем, даже если установка прошла успешно. Это происходило как в Ubuntu 18.10, так и в Fedora 29.

После того, как скрипт завершит установку тем GNOME, используйте GNOME Tweaks, чтобы изменить тему Gtk.

Больше информации на странице README репозитория "Install GNOME Themes".

Оригинал: Install GNOME Themes - Script To Install Over 40 Popular Gtk Themes

Комментариев нет:

Отправить комментарий